The business district of Barcelona is characterized by its modern infrastructure, strategic location, and proximity to major transportation hubs. This region primarily encompasses areas like the Eixample, Poble Nou, and the financial sector around Plaça Catalunya. Each of these neighborhoods offers distinct investment advantages that are appealing to both local and international investors.
Prime Locations to Consider
1. Eixample District
The Eixample district is renowned for its elegant street grid and iconic Modernist buildings. Featuring a mix of residential and commercial properties, it is ideal for investors seeking long-term rental income. Properties near Passeig de Gràcia, a major avenue filled with high-end boutiques and businesses, are particularly desirable as they attract both tourists and affluent locals.
2. Poble Nou
Once an industrial zone, Poble Nou has undergone significant transformation and is now known as the tech hub of Barcelona, often referred to as the '22@ district'. The area is home to many startups and tech companies, making it appealing for investors interested in commercial properties or mixed-use developments. With ongoing urban revitalization, prices are expected to rise, presenting an excellent investment opportunity.
3. Plaça Catalunya
As one of Barcelona's main squares, Plaça Catalunya serves as a major transportation junction and is a bustling commercial and retail center. Investing in properties here can yield high foot traffic and visibility for retail businesses. The mix of residential apartments and office spaces makes it a sought-after area for diverse investment strategies.
Types of Investment Properties
1. Residential Apartments
Barcelona’s attractive climate and lifestyle make residential apartments a favorable investment. Properties in the business district attract expatriates and professionals looking for housing close to work. Investing in well-located apartments can provide consistent monthly rental income and potential appreciation in property value.
2. Commercial Spaces
With numerous businesses establishing offices in Barcelona, commercial properties in the business district are highly sought after. Retail spaces, especially those near busy streets like Passeig de Gràcia, can yield significant returns thanks to high rental prices. Commercial real estate investments often come with longer lease agreements, providing stability for investors.
3. Serviced Apartments
The growing tourism sector in Barcelona creates demand for serviced apartments. These properties cater to travelers seeking short-term stays and can be an excellent investment. By converting residential units into short-term rentals, investors can take advantage of higher nightly rates, particularly during peak tourist seasons.
Factors to Consider When Investing
1. Market Trends
Staying informed about market trends is crucial. Barcelona's real estate market has shown resilience and continues to grow, but understanding local conditions, such as supply and demand dynamics, community plans, and foreign investment policies, can help you make informed decisions.
2. Property Regulations
Investing in Barcelona requires knowledge of local property laws and regulations. Navigating through the bureaucratic landscape, especially concerning short-term rentals, can be complex. It’s advisable to consult with local real estate experts or legal advisors to ensure compliance.
3. Financing Options
Considering the financial aspects of your investment is critical. Look into various financing options, including local banks offering mortgages to foreign buyers. Evaluating these options can help you better manage your investment and cash flow.
